About This Vintage 1948 Edition
"Championship Ball" by Clair Bee, published by Grosset & Dunlap in 1948, is a captivating entry in the renowned Chip Hilton sports series. This hardcover edition, printed in New York, captures the excitement and challenges of basketball through the eyes of the beloved protagonist, Chip Hilton. Clair Bee, a celebrated coach and author, brings authenticity and passion to the narrative, making it a cherished read for young sports enthusiasts. While the copyright page confirms the 1948 publication year, the specific edition details are not visible. This book is an essential piece for collectors of vintage sports fiction, particularly those focusing on mid-20th-century young adult literature. The book's cover features a simple yet iconic basketball hoop illustration, reflecting its sports theme.
